description The aim of this study was to determine characters that affect seed and hay yield, using simple correlation coefficients and path analysis. The study was conducted in Batı Akdeniz Agricultural Research Institute (BAARI), during 2014-2015 winter growing seasons for two years. The experiments were established in a randomized complete block design with three replications and half of plots for fresh forage and the other half for seeds were harvested. In the study, days to 50% flowering, plant height, fresh yield, hay yield, straw yield, biological yield, harvest index, number of pods per plant, number of seeds per pod, seed yield and 1000-seed weight were observed. According to results of the correlation analysis; a highly significant and positive correlations (P<0.01) were determined between fresh yield, hay yield, biological yield and seed yield. According to the results of the path analysis, the highest direct effect on the hay yield was obtained from fresh yield and straw yield. As a result of the research, to increase the hay yield; straw and fresh yield, and to increase the seed yield; biological yield and harvest index can be suggested as main selection criteria on grass pea breeding studies.
